Woman who launched jewellery brand with five items now owns multimillion pound business

A woman who started a jewellery brand with just five items is now the owner of a multimillion pound business.

Charlotte Donoghue, 31, is celebrating six years since she launched Say It With Diamonds.

The entrepreneur started her business in June of 2016 with just five necklaces - and has since seen her company grow into a successful empire.

Charlotte, who lives in Aintree, started her business by showcasing her five trial designs to Instagram and Facebook.

But within just hours of posting her products, Say It With Diamonds had ten orders for necklaces that are still in high demand today.

Reinvesting into the business and stock, Charlotte continued to buy more and more luxury pieces which saw the brand continue to grow, reports Liverpool Echo.

“From the very beginning, we’ve focused on products of the highest quality. We’ve tried and tested different suppliers to get the best luxury jewellery possible,” said Charlotte.

“Going hand in hand with this, customer service has been at the forefront of our business and providing the best service is absolutely key for us.

“Like all businesses, at the start we had a few teething problems but it was our approach to those situations that really mattered.

“Our first complaint was about a full diamond initial necklace and we refunded the customer in full and recalled the others that had sold.

"As we had hand delivered them, we visited each house to collect the necklaces and took it as a lesson learnt, always paying more for higher quality products. After all, you get what you pay for.

"We started as we meant to go on and this calibre of service is what would stand us in great stead to create a million pound company just two years later.

“We understand that our customers are purchasing special items or precious gifts and we’re here to make that experience memorable and the best it can possibly be.”

Charlotte initially worked from home to kickstart her business.

But by January 2017, the businesswoman and her small team found their first office, kitted out with leopard print walls, two desks and two winged high back black chairs.

Charlotte added: “It was our happy place and where we really focused on branching out into areas we wanted to focus on; bridal, engagement jewellery and rings.

“We were so fortunate to meet some lovely people that they fell right into our hands.”

Networking, influencer marketing and social media has been fundamental to Say It With Diamonds’ success and Charlotte continued to meet more people within the jewellery industry including talented jewellers, making regular trips to London to work on the brand’s awareness.

The amount of pieces the brand stocks has also grown substantially, with Charlotte and the team focusing on their bestsellers and customer favourites as well as constantly evolving with the aim of offering the best quality jewellery at competitive prices.

Say It With Diamonds marks six years in business in June and Charlotte is incredibly proud to have grown her team to 19 staff in house, as well as a huge team they outsource.

She added: "This year has been monumental for Say It With Diamonds. We’ve just had an incredible Christmas with our Liverpool ONE pop up, which we opened to manage the queues at our Metquarter store, being a huge success.

"Despite the pandemic we’ve also seen huge growth through our website.

“This success hasn’t been overnight and it’s been almost six years of nonstop hard work, determination and innovation and I can’t thank our amazing team enough for their dedication to helping to make Say It With Diamonds the business it is today."
